#1e6042 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#1e6042 is composed of 11.8% red, 37.6% green and 25.9%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 68.8% cyan, 0% magenta, 31.3% yellow and 62.4% black. It has a hue angle of 152.7 degrees, a saturation of 52.4% and a lightness of 24.7%. #1e6042 color hex could be obtained by blending #3cc084 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#336633.

Shades and Tints of #1e6042

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#020604 is the darkest color, while #f6fcfa is the lightest one.

Tones of #1e6042

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#3b433f is the less saturated color, while #017d45 is the most saturated one.
